If you are able please check some language settings either, and maybe you have to open multiple tickets according to the other system-config-xxx tools (time, region, and so on...). Also if your language is new, I suggest to translate first the main websites what can be translated continuously, and gets a pull and refresh by approx every hour. Robyduck maintaining them, and in translation perion we have a staging site - where you can see the updates quicker. For Fedora apps I suggest to begin with the biggest chunk - the installer GUI, called anaconda. If that is finished, that will help greatly mainly in the translation memory of Zanata - and when we get new translation ISO snapshot, and chance for review - you can test out that how it's worked.
